Bio Sketch

Dr. Trela received her doctorate in 2001 and has been involved in higher education and program development since her graduation.  She has served the UMass Lowell Psychology Department as an instructor since 1997, teaching courses in General Psychology, Social Psychology, Interpersonal Relationships, Child and Adolescent Development and Adult Development. 

Dr. Trela has had an opportunity to teach and develop courses in Psychology and Business at other schools of higher education since her graduation: Assessment and Measures in Psychology, Behavior Modification, Development Psychology, Team Development, Group Behavior, Communication, Conflict Management, Organizational Concepts and Leadership and Organizational Behavior.  Past research areas include conflict management and program development/assessment, leadership development, interpersonal relationships, behavioral competencies.
